揭秘网络服务器错误1016,轻松解决之道

资源类型:2wx.net 2024-12-08 05:50

网络服务器错误1016简介:



网络服务器错误1016:深入解析与应对策略 在数字化时代,网络已经成为我们生活和工作中不可或缺的一部分

    然而,网络并非万能,时常会遭遇各种故障和问题,其中网络服务器错误1016便是一个较为常见且令人困扰的问题

    本文将深入探讨网络服务器错误1016的成因、表现、影响以及应对策略,帮助读者更好地理解和解决这一难题

     一、网络服务器错误1016的概述 网络服务器错误1016,特别是在WebSocket协议中,是一个特定的错误代码,表示连接由于无法完成TLS握手而被关闭

    TLS(传输层安全协议)握手是建立安全连接的过程,用于确保数据传输的机密性和完整性

    如果握手失败,连接将被终止,并返回错误代码1016

     二、网络服务器错误1016的成因 网络服务器错误1016的成因多种多样,以下是几个主要原因: 1.服务器证书问题: -证书过期:服务器使用的TLS证书可能已经过期,导致客户端无法验证服务器的身份

     -证书无效:证书可能由不受信任的证书颁发机构签发,或证书的配置有误(如主机名不匹配)

     2.TLS版本不匹配: - 客户端和服务器之间的TLS版本可能不兼容

    例如,服务器可能只支持TLS 1.2,而客户端仍在使用较旧的TLS 1.0或TLS 1.1

     3.TLS支持库问题: - 客户端或服务器的TLS支持库可能过时,存在漏洞或不支持某些加密算法

     4.网络连接问题: - 网络连接不稳定或速度过慢,可能导致TLS握手过程中断

     5.服务器故障或维护: - 服务器可能正在进行维护,或出现故障,导致无法正常处理TLS握手请求

     三、网络服务器错误1016的表现 网络服务器错误1016的表现通常包括以下几个方面: 1.连接失败: - 客户端尝试建立WebSocket连接时,连接失败,并返回错误代码1016

     2.安全警告: - 在某些情况下,浏览器或客户端可能会显示安全警告,提示TLS握手失败

     3.日志记录: - 客户端和服务器的日志中会记录TLS握手失败的详细信息,包括错误代码和可能的原因

     4.应用故障: - 依赖于WebSocket连接的应用可能会因为连接失败而无法正常工作

     四、网络服务器错误1016的影响 网络服务器错误1016对用户和开发者都带来了显著的影响: 1.用户体验下降: - 用户可能无法正常使用依赖于WebSocket连接的应用,导致体验下降

     2.数据安全性受损: - TLS握手失败意味着连接不是安全的,数据在传输过程中可能被截获或篡改

     3.开发者调试困难: - 开发者需要花费大量时间和精力来排查和修复TLS握手失败的问题

     4.业务损失: - 对于依赖实时通信的应用(如在线游戏、实时聊天等),TLS握手失败可能导致用户流失和业务损失

     五、应对网络服务器错误1016的策略 针对网络服务器错误1016,我们可以采取以下策略来应对: 1.检查服务器证书: - 确保服务器证书没有过期,并且由受信任的证书颁发机构签发

     - 检查证书的主机名是否与客户端请求的主机名匹配

     - 使用在线工具或命令行工具(如OpenSSL)来验证证书的有效性

     2.更新TLS版本和支持库: - 确保客户端和服务器支持相同的TLS版本,并更新到最新的TLS支持库

     - 如果使用的是第三方库或框架,确保它们也是最新版本,并检查是否有与TLS握手相关的修复补丁

     3.优化网络连接: - 检查网络连接是否稳定,并优化网络配置

阅读全文
上一篇:云服务器:北京VS上海,哪里更优?

最新收录:

  • 刀片服务器:高效能应用场景全解析
  • 云服务器:北京VS上海,哪里更优?
  • 山东淘宝SEO优化技巧揭秘
  • 刀片服务器:如何安全拔出硬盘教程
  • 网络服务器搭建、配置与管理指南
  • 腾讯审核通过,云服务器备案成功
  • 刀片服务器:高效能、低成本的IT利器
  • 搭建网络服务器,打造文化节目新平台
  • 云服务器备案价格查询指南
  • 网络服务器搭建与管理实战指南
  • 云服务器备案:必要性与安全性解析
  • 刀片服务器:高效能优势解析
  • 首页 | 网络服务器错误1016:揭秘网络服务器错误1016,轻松解决之道